Transform lives as a Casual Specialized Child/Youth Support Worker at Strive Living Society in Richmond. Work in a two-to-one support setting focusing on neurodiverse individuals and mental health challenges.
Join Strive Living
Society, a non-profit based in Richmond, dedicated to supporting children, youth, and adults. This part-time position requires experience with neurodiversity, effective communication, and behavior management skills. You’ll engage in a collaborative team to ensure person-centered care and assist individuals with daily tasks, fostering meaningful connections. Key Responsibilities:
- Provide primary support in a cooperative team setting
- Implement safety and behavior support plans
- Complete documentation including daily logs and incident reports
- Assist with household tasks and personal care
- Build relationships and rapport in a safe, positive environment Requirements:
- Class 5 BC Driver's License and clean driver's abstract
- Minimum of 1-year experience with neurodiverse individuals
- Criminal Record Clearance and First Aid certification
- Effective de-escalation skills and trauma-informed approach
- Ability to follow health care and safety plans You’ll make a significant impact while developing your skills in this rewarding social services role.
